Description
Dive into a blend of classic design and modern versatility with the Bacchus PJ Bass. This electric bass guitar is a perfect fusion of precision and jazz bass elements, offering musicians the ability to explore a broad range of tones. With its dual pickup configuration, the PJ Bass caters to the needs of players who demand both clarity and punch in their sound. Whether you're laying down a groovy line in a funk ensemble or driving the rhythm in a rock band, this bass handles it all with finesse.
Crafted with meticulous attention to detail, the Bacchus PJ Bass features a smooth and fast neck, making it ideal for both beginners and seasoned players alike. The body is designed for comfort and ease of play, ensuring that long sessions are as enjoyable as they are productive. Its robust hardware and electronics provide reliability and consistency, allowing you to focus on what truly matters—your performance.

Owner Insights
We analyzed real musician discussions from forums and Reddit to find what players love, question, and tweak about Bacchus PJ Bass.
Build quality
-
The roasted maple neck and stainless steel frets offer a unique brightness, which some attribute to the overall sound profile of the bass.
Source -
The reddish brown pick guard is highlighted for its unique aesthetic, complementing the black oil finish and gold accents, enhancing the bass's visual appeal.
Source
Setup and maintenance
-
Tuning stability is a recurring issue, partially attributed to the stock tuners, which are noted as needing frequent adjustments.
Source
Mods and upgrades
-
There's a challenge in finding a drop-in bridge due to the four screw holes positioned at the corners, limiting easy bridge replacement options.
Source
Features and functionality
Comparisons
-
The model is likened to entry-level brands like Squier but praised for its solid foundation and potential for customization and upgrades.
